Car Shopping? The ‘Big, Beautiful Bill’ May Change What You Pay

Car Shopping? The ‘Big, Beautiful Bill’ May Change What You Pay
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


The “one massive, stunning invoice” was signed into regulation by President Donald Trump final week, with a achieve for some automobile patrons and a loss for others. Customers might now profit from tax deductions on auto loans, however electrical automobile patrons will lose the financial savings offered by EV tax credit.

Auto mortgage curiosity now tax-deductible for some debtors

Automotive patrons who finance will be capable of deduct as much as $10,000 a yr for automobile mortgage curiosity they pay. The deduction is “above-the-line,” which means it is going to apply to individuals who declare the usual deduction and those that itemize.

To be eligible, automobile patrons and their vehicles might want to meet the next standards[0].

Automobile {qualifications}

New buy. The deduction applies solely to new autos, not used ones.

U.S. meeting. The automobile will need to have ultimate meeting in america.

Private use. The deduction is for personal-use autos, excluding business autos and leases.

Earnings limitations

Single filers. The deduction begins phasing out at a modified adjusted gross revenue (MAGI) of $100,000. 

Joint filers. Section-out begins at a MAGI of $200,000.

Section-out quantity. For each $1,000 of revenue over the only and joint filer threshold, the accessible deduction declines by $200. 

The intent of the auto mortgage curiosity deduction is to make vehicles extra reasonably priced for patrons, on condition that common automobile costs and rates of interest stay excessive. However the profit for some automobile patrons will likely be restricted.

The truth is, an individual would wish to get an auto mortgage of greater than $110,000 to profit from the utmost deduction, in response to Cox Automotive Chief Economist Jonathan Smoke.

For context, the common new automobile transaction value is about $49,000. Most autos priced at $110,000 or above could be luxurious sedans or sports activities vehicles, and solely about 1% of all auto loans are of that measurement.

“The everyday new mortgage actually would solely see round $500 profit, and that’s in yr one after which declining over time,” Smoke mentioned on the Cox Automotive 2025 Mid-12 months Evaluation on June 25.

Common month-to-month automobile funds are round $750, and a report one in 5 new automobile patrons dedicated to $1,000+ funds within the second quarter of 2025, in response to Edmunds.com. So, for many debtors, the annual financial savings in mortgage curiosity could be lower than their month-to-month automobile fee.

The auto mortgage curiosity deduction can be non permanent — efficient for tax years 2025 by means of 2028.

Do you know…

Deducting auto mortgage curiosity isn’t a brand new concept. Previous to 1991, auto mortgage curiosity might be claimed as an itemized tax deduction, till it was phased out as a part of the Tax Reform Act of 1986.

Say goodbye to EV tax credit

Previously a number of years, EV patrons and lessees have taken benefit of federal tax credit established underneath the Inflation Discount Act — as much as $7,500 for brand spanking new EVs and $4,000 for used. The “one massive, stunning invoice” eliminates this EV credit score for autos bought and leased after September 30, 2025[0].

Automotive patrons planning to make the most of EV tax credit ought to achieve this prior to later. Along with grabbing the credit score earlier than it’s gone, automobile customers might discover extra EV incentives at dealerships wanting to maneuver stock.

Auto business teams had pushed for extra time to advertise EV gross sales earlier than the tax credit score ends, however their makes an attempt have been unsuccessful.

Will curiosity financial savings offset tariff-driven value will increase?

The auto mortgage curiosity deduction is supposed to enhance automobile affordability, however it gained’t do a lot to assist automobile patrons going through value hikes from tariffs. Right here’s a breakdown to elucidate why.

Imported vehicles have a 25% tariff. If the automobile you purchase is foreign-built, you’re more likely to pay extra resulting from tariffs — and you’ll’t declare the mortgage curiosity deduction. A lose-lose. 

Imported automobile components have a 25% tariff. All vehicles with ultimate meeting within the U.S. use some quantity of foreign-made content material, in response to the vehicles.com American-made index. Anderson Financial Group estimates components tariffs on these vehicles will improve their value by not less than $2,000. So, whilst you can declare the curiosity deduction, its profit is more likely to fall in need of the upper value you pay for the automobile. A win (type of)-lose.

100%-American-made vehicles don’t have any tariffs. In principle, this needs to be a win-win, as a result of this class of autos would don’t have any tariff-related value will increase and would qualify for the curiosity deduction, however they don’t really exist (confer with the second bullet level).

Whereas the tax deduction auto mortgage curiosity could also be a small win for some automobile patrons, it doesn’t go far sufficient to offset the anticipated value improve of tariffs for many.

Sensible steps to scale back the price of shopping for a automobile

Whether or not you achieve a tax deduction or lose a tax credit score from passage of the “one massive, stunning invoice,” excessive automobile costs and rates of interest make it extra necessary than ever to arrange earlier than buying a automobile.

Listed here are methods that can assist you scale back your automobile value and safe a month-to-month fee that matches your price range.

1. Analysis pricing benchmarks. Earlier than stepping right into a dealership, search for the truthful market worth of the automobile you’re contemplating. Use on-line instruments like Kelley Blue Guide, Edmunds or NADA Guides to get a practical concept of what it’s best to anticipate to pay.

2. Perceive how auto loans work. In the event you plan to finance, take time to be taught the fundamentals of auto loans — together with how automobile mortgage size impacts your whole value and the way your credit score profile impacts your rate of interest. Being knowledgeable will help you keep away from unfavorable mortgage phrases.

3. Examine financing provides. Don’t mechanically settle for the primary mortgage give you obtain. Examine charges and phrases from banks, credit score unions and on-line lenders to discover probably the most aggressive auto mortgage. Even a small distinction in rate of interest can result in important financial savings over time.

4. Use an auto mortgage calculator. Earlier than making use of for a mortgage, run the numbers utilizing an auto mortgage calculator. Alter variables like mortgage quantity, rate of interest, time period and down fee to discover a month-to-month fee that aligns together with your monetary objectives.
